Proceeding contribution from Iain Stewart (Conservative) in the House of Commons on Tuesday, 21 June 2011. It occurred during Debate on bill on Scotland Bill.


Scotland Bill

I know, but I believe I have a better one and I shall turn to it in a moment. The arguments are beguiling. The hon. Member for Vauxhall (Kate Hoey) said that she has correspondence from constituents asking why on the face of it Scottish residents have a much better deal from the UK public purse than people in England. I receive similar letters asking why prescriptions are free north of the border, but there is a charge in England. That issue has to be tackled.
